Beyond Scratch Resistance: The True Nonstick Trade-Off
The fundamental split in nonstick cookware, from inexpensive graniteware like the CAROTE Nonstick Frying Pan Skillet to premium hybrids such as HexClad 8 Inch Hybrid Nonstick Frying Pan, hinges not on scratch resistance, but on the trade-off between searing capability and absolute food release without added oil.
While many point to ceramic or PFOA-free coatings as the pinnacle, the real innovation lies in hybridization. Pans like the OXO Hybrid 8” Nonstick Stainless Steel Frying Pan or the Henckels Paradigm Stainless Steel 10” Fry Pan leverage this by embedding nonstick elements within a more robust structure, often tri-ply stainless steel. This construction, as seen in the OXO 10” Non-Stick Every Day Frying Pan, provides superior heat conduction and retention compared to pure aluminum bases found in some All-Clad HA1 Hard Anodized Non Stick Fry Pan Set 2 models, leading to better browning and a more satisfying sear.
The etched patterns on OXO Hybrid or hexagonal textures on HexClad models are designed to allow fat to pool for searing while still facilitating release, a balance not found in simpler ceramic surfaces.
However, this hybrid approach inherently means the nonstick layer is less dominant than in dedicated nonstick pans. While superior to older Teflon constructions and often boasting higher heat tolerance, the ultimate adhesion-free experience for incredibly delicate items like paper-thin crepes or meticulously cooked fish where zero oil is desired, might still be found in ceramic-infused designs like the CARAWAY Nonstick Ceramic Frying Pan or the OXO 10” Non-Stick Every Day Frying Pan, provided they are used and maintained with absolute care to preserve the coating. The challenge is that these purely nonstick surfaces can be more susceptible to degradation over time and may not offer the same aggressive searing capabilities.
Ultimately, the best non stick pan material choice depends on prioritizing either the ability to achieve a hard sear with moderate oil, or the absolute, oil-free, slide-off-the-pan release for the most sensitive ingredients. What to Look for in Best Non Stick Pan Material
Nonstick coating types
When choosing a nonstick coating, prioritize PFOA-free certified ceramic for its excellent food release and gentle cooking. PTFE (Teflon) coatings offer superior nonstick performance for searing and quick cooking, but opt for reputable brands with multi-layer construction to ensure good durability. Newer hybrid technologies merge the benefits of both, providing a balance of nonstick ease and enhanced resilience.
For everyday cooking and healthier meals, select ceramic. For high-heat searing and rapid cooking needs, choose a well-constructed PTFE pan.
For the best of both worlds, a hybrid option is your ideal choice.
Durability and longevity
Durability hinges on the coating’s scratch resistance and heat tolerance. A good nonstick pan will withstand daily use with plastic or silicone utensils without immediate degradation. Conversely, coatings that easily chip or scratch, especially when exposed to metal utensils, have a short lifespan.
Look for pans with multiple reinforced coating layers and higher heat tolerance ratings, indicating they won’t warp or break down under typical stovetop temperatures. Pans with exceptional scratch resistance and high heat capabilities will last significantly longer, making them a sound investment for frequent cooks.
Handle material and ergonomics
Consider handle material and construction for safe and comfortable use. Excellent nonstick pans feature heat-resistant silicone grips that stay cool during cooking, preventing burns. Stainless steel handles offer robust durability and are often oven-safe.
Confirm the oven-safe temperature rating on the handle to ensure it meets your needs. Riveted handles provide superior strength and longevity, resisting loosening over time, whereas permanently attached handles can sometimes be a point of weak adhesion.
Opt for a pan with a comfortable, heat-resistant grip and a securely riveted stainless steel handle for maximum safety and enduring performance.

Frequently Asked Questions
What Is The Safest Best Non Stick Pan Material?
Ceramic-coated pans are often considered the safest best non stick pan material, as they do not contain PTFE or PFOA chemicals. These ceramic surfaces offer excellent nonstick properties and are generally free from concerns about off-gassing at high temperatures.
How Does Ptfe Affect The Best Non Stick Pan Material?
PTFE, commonly known as Teflon, is a popular choice for the best non stick pan material due to its superior slipperiness. When used correctly and not overheated, PTFE coatings provide an excellent nonstick cooking surface that makes food release easy.
Are Ceramic Nonstick Pans As Effective As Traditional Ones?
Ceramic nonstick pans are highly effective for general cooking, offering good food release without the use of PTFE. While they may not offer the absolute slickness of some PTFE pans, their safety profile is a significant advantage for many home cooks.
What Does ‘Pfoa-Free’ Mean For Nonstick Pans?
PFOA-free means that the manufacturing process for the best non stick pan material did not involve perfluorooctanoic acid. This is important because PFOA has been linked to health concerns, so PFOA-free pans offer a healthier cooking alternative.
How Can I Extend The Life Of My Best Non Stick Pan Material?
To extend the life of your best non stick pan material, always use low to medium heat, avoid metal utensils, and never preheat the pan while empty. Handwashing with a soft sponge is also crucial for preserving the nonstick coating.
